This is a 1971 Fender Musicmaster Bass with all original parts. It has the rare factory-installed pearloid pickguard rather than the plain white one that most of these guitars had. The finish has some wear and tear but is still in good condition for its age. It is a darker red than it appears in the photos, the camera on my phone isn't very good.

It sounds great and plays very nicely with a low action. The neck is straight, the frets are in good shape and the truss rod works. The pickup and all of the electronics work fine. It is currently fitted with a set of GHS Precision flatwound strings which haven't seen much use. Overall this guitar is a very nice early example in one of the more desirable colours.
